    A NEW EXTREME RDNA ARCHITECTURE

    he Radeon RX 5700 Series GPUs are powered by the new RDNA architecture, the heart of AMD’s advanced 7nm technology process. RDNA features up to 40 completely redesigned Compute Units delivering incredible performance and up to 4x IPC improvements, new instructions better suited for visual effects such as volumetric lighting, blur effects, and depth of field, and multi-level cache hierarchy for greatly reduced latency and highly responsive gaming. The RDNA architecture enables DisplayPort 1.4 with Display Stream Compression for extreme refresh rates and resolutions on cutting edge displays for insanely immersive gameplay.

    Reviewed in the United States on November 4, 2019
    Foreword:
    • Upgraded from MSI GTX 970
    • Paired with i5-4690k @ 3.9GHz, 16GB(2x8) DDR3 1600MHz, Gigabyte B85N Phoenix Wi-Fi. [built in 2015}

    1 Month review:
    AMD software has taken some time to get used to compared to NVIDIA's. (my first AMD card)
    May be having some Displayport issues (no picture/ constant black screen flickering), unsure if it's my monitor, cable, or GPU; right now running HDMI for the time being.

    Recently only been playing Modern Warfare at 1440p (60Hz); in the market for a 144Hz 1440p monitor.
    With the game's frame limiter turned off, I see a max of 200+ FPS a minimun; of ~50FPS; and an average of ~ 120+ FPS. Card only sees ~40°C - 50°C at 100% in this game (ambient Temp: 25°C)
    [will update more games when I get around to it.]

    Blower card keeps the case cool, but can be noisy under load. May need to tweak fan curve.
